首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何用pandas编辑大的json文件?

Pandas是一个强大的数据处理和分析工具,可以用于编辑大的JSON文件。下面是使用Pandas编辑大的JSON文件的步骤:

  1. 导入必要的库:
代码语言:txt
复制
import pandas as pd
import json
  1. 读取JSON文件:
代码语言:txt
复制
with open('file.json', 'r') as f:
    data = json.load(f)
  1. 将JSON数据转换为Pandas的DataFrame:
代码语言:txt
复制
df = pd.json_normalize(data)
  1. 对DataFrame进行编辑和处理: 可以使用Pandas提供的各种函数和方法对DataFrame进行编辑和处理,例如添加、删除、修改列,筛选数据,计算统计指标等。
  2. 将编辑后的DataFrame保存为JSON文件:
代码语言:txt
复制
df.to_json('edited_file.json', orient='records', lines=True)

在上述步骤中,file.json是要编辑的原始JSON文件的文件名,edited_file.json是保存编辑后的JSON文件的文件名。

Pandas的优势在于其强大的数据处理和分析功能,可以轻松处理大型数据集。它提供了丰富的函数和方法,使得数据的编辑和处理变得简单高效。

使用Pandas编辑大的JSON文件的应用场景包括但不限于:

  • 数据清洗和预处理:可以通过Pandas对大型JSON文件进行清洗和预处理,例如删除重复数据、处理缺失值、转换数据类型等。
  • 数据分析和统计:Pandas提供了丰富的统计函数和方法,可以对大型JSON文件中的数据进行分析和统计,例如计算均值、中位数、标准差等。
  • 数据可视化:Pandas可以与其他数据可视化库(如Matplotlib和Seaborn)结合使用,对大型JSON文件中的数据进行可视化展示,帮助用户更好地理解数据。

腾讯云提供了云原生数据库TDSQL、云数据库CDB、云数据库MongoDB等产品,可以用于存储和管理大型数据集。您可以根据具体需求选择适合的产品。更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:腾讯云数据库产品

请注意,本回答仅提供了使用Pandas编辑大的JSON文件的基本步骤和一些相关产品的介绍,具体的实现方式和产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何用 Python 和 API 收集与分析网络数据?

你只需要把样例代码全部拷贝下来,用文本编辑器保存为“.py”为扩展名 Python 脚本文件,例如 demo.py 。...大不了,我们还可以把数据框直接导出为 Excel 文件,扔到熟悉 Excel 环境里面,去绘制图形。 读入 Python 数据框工具 pandas 。...import pandas as pd 我们让 Pandas 将刚刚保留下来列表,转换为数据框,存入 df 。...接口,获得结果数据; 如何使用 Python 3 和更人性化 HTTP 工具包 requests 调用 API 获得数据; 如何用 JSON 工具包解析处理获得字符串数据; 如何用 Pandas...转换 JSON 列表为数据框; 如何将测试通过后简单 Python 语句打包成函数,以反复调用,提高效率; 如何用 plotnine (ggplot2克隆)绘制时间序列折线图,对比不同城市 AQI

3.3K20

pandas.DataFrame.to_csv函数入门

执行代码后,将会在当前目录下生成一个名为"data.csv"文件,保存了DataFrame中数据。可以使用文本编辑器或Excel等工具打开该文件验证保存结果。...运行代码后,会在当前目录下生成一个​​student_data.csv​​文件,可以使用文本编辑器或其他工具打开查看数据。...下面我将详细介绍一下​​to_csv​​函数缺点,并且列举出一些类似的函数。缺点:内存消耗:当DataFrame中数据量非常时,使用​​to_csv​​函数保存数据可能会占用大量内存。...pandas.DataFrame.to_sql​​:该函数可以将DataFrame中数据存储到SQL数据库中,支持各种常见数据库,MySQL、PostgreSQL等。​​...pandas.DataFrame.to_json​​:该函数可以将DataFrame中数据保存为JSON格式文件。​​

82830
  • 何用Python读取开放数据?

    当你开始接触丰富多彩开放数据集时,CSV、JSON和XML等格式名词就会奔涌而来。如何用Python高效地读取它们,为后续整理和分析做准备呢?本文为你一步步展示过程,你自己也可以动手实践。...最常见,是以下几种: CSV XML JSON 你希望自己能调用Python来清理和分析它们,从而完成自己“数据炼金术”。 第一步,你先得学会如何用Python读取这些开放数据格式。...可以看到,JSON文件就像是一个字典(dictionary)。我们选择其中某个索引,就能获得对应数据。 我们选择“dataset”: 下面是结果前几行。 我们关心数据在“data”下面。...小结 至此,你已经尝试了如何把CSV、JSON和XML数据读入到Pandas数据框,并且做最基本时间序列可视化展示。...你可能会有以下疑问: 既然CSV文件这么小巧,Pandas读取起来也方便,为什么还要费劲去学那么难用JSON和XML数据读取方法呢? 这是个好问题! 我能想到,至少有两个原因。

    2.6K80

    何用Python读取开放数据?

    当你开始接触丰富多彩开放数据集时,CSV、JSON和XML等格式名词就会奔涌而来。如何用Python高效地读取它们,为后续整理和分析做准备呢?本文为你一步步展示过程,你自己也可以动手实践。 ?...最常见,是以下几种: CSV XML JSON 你希望自己能调用Python来清理和分析它们,从而完成自己“数据炼金术”。 第一步,你先得学会如何用Python读取这些开放数据格式。...我们在Jupyter Notebook中打开下载JSON文件,检视其内容: ? 我们需要数据都在里面,下面我们回到Python笔记本文件ipynb中,尝试读取JSON数据内容。...文件就像是一个字典(dictionary)。...你可能会有以下疑问: 既然CSV文件这么小巧,Pandas读取起来也方便,为什么还要费劲去学那么难用JSON和XML数据读取方法呢? 这是个好问题! 我能想到,至少有两个原因。

    1.9K20

    周杰伦在唱什么?数据可视化告诉你!

    第一种方法,先把 JSON 文件转换为 Excel 可以打开 .csv 文件或 .xlsx 文件格式。这可以借助一些在线转换工具完成( JSON to CSV Converter)。...import json 然后,读取我们下载 JSON 文件,存储在名为 data 变量中。...首先引入 jieba 库(安装 :pip install jieba)、pandas 库(安装 :pip install pandas)、用于频次统计 Counter 库,以及表单工具,代码如下。...分词之后,删除停用词、去除无用符号等。用 Counter 库对清洗干净词语进行频次统计。然后将统计结果用 pandas库转换为数据表单,存储为 Excel 文件,代码如下。...调整完毕后,单击右上角“下载到本地”按钮即可。 图5 在左侧编辑“形状”中,可以替换词云蒙版。

    70910

    猫头虎分享:Python库 Pandas 简介、安装、用法详解入门教程

    本篇博客将深入介绍Pandas功能,从安装到基础用法,再到常见问题解决,让大家能轻松掌握如何用Pandas处理和分析数据。...它提供了DataFrame和Series两核心数据结构,能够帮助我们轻松应对大规模数据导入、清洗、处理与分析工作。 ️...数据读取与存储 Pandas支持读取多种格式文件数据,CSV、Excel、SQL数据库等。...A: 在处理大规模数据时,可以考虑使用以下方式提升性能: 使用 chunk 逐块读取大文件; 使用 Dask 作为Pandas替代方案,处理分布式数据; 对常用操作使用Pandas内置 向量化操作...本文总结与未来趋势展望 操作 命令 解释 安装Pandas pip install pandas 安装Pandas库 读取CSV文件 pd.read_csv('data.csv') 读取CSV文件 创建

    13810

    手把手教你用Pandas读取所有主流数据存储

    作者:李庆辉 来源:大数据DT(ID:hzdashuju) Pandas提供了一组顶层I/O API,pandas.read_csv()等方法,这些方法可以将众多格式数据读取到DataFrame...Pandas可以读取、处理大体量数据,通过技术手段,理论上Pandas可以处理数据体量无限。编程可以更加自由地实现复杂逻辑,逻辑代码可以进行封装、重复使用并可实现自动化。...Pandas提供JSON读取方法在解析网络爬虫数据时,可以极大地提高效率。...可如下读取JSON文件: # data.json为同目录下一个文件 pd.read_json('data.json') 可以解析一个JSON字符串,以下是从HTTP服务检测到设备信息: jdata=...返回有多个df列表,则可以通过索引取第几个。如果页面里只有一个表格,那么这个列表就只有一个DataFrame。此方法是Pandas提供一个简单实用实现爬虫功能方法。

    2.8K10

    n种方式教你用python读写excel等数据文件

    python处理数据文件途径有很多种,可以操作文件类型主要包括文本文件(csv、txt、json等)、excel文件、数据库文件、api等其他数据文件。...库 pandas是数据处理最常用分析库之一,可以读取各种各样格式数据文件,一般输出dataframe格式。...:txt、csv、excel、json、剪切板、数据库、html、hdf、parquet、pickled文件、sas、stata等等 read_csv方法read_csv方法用来读取csv格式文件,输出...pd pd.read_excel('test.xlsx') read_table方法 通过对sep参数(分隔符)控制来对任何文本文件读取 read_json方法 读取json格式文件 df = pd.DataFrame...openpyxl 主要针对xlsx格式excel进行读取和编辑 xlwings 对xlsx、xls、xlsm格式文件进行读写、格式修改等操作 xlsxwriter 用来生成excel表格,插入数据、

    4K10

    用pythonpandas打开csv文件_如何使用Pandas DataFrame打开CSV文件 – python

    大家好,又见面了,我是你们朋友全栈君。 有一个带有三列数据框CSV格式文件。 第三栏文字较长。...当我尝试使用pandas.read_csv打开文件时,出现此错误消息 message : UnicodeDecodeError: ‘utf-8’ codec can’t decode byte 0xa1...那么,如何打开该文件并获取数据框? 参考方案 试试这个: 在文本编辑器中打开cvs文件,并确保将其保存为utf-8格式。...然后照常读取文件: import pandas csvfile = pandas.read_csv(‘file.csv’, encoding=’utf-8′) 如何使用Pandas groupby在组上添加顺序计数器列...如何用’-‘解析字符串到节点js本地脚本? – python 我正在使用本地节点js脚本来处理字符串。我陷入了将’-‘字符串解析为本地节点js脚本问题。render.js:#!

    11.7K30

    python数据分析——数据分析数据导入和导出

    有时候从后台系统里导出来数据就是JSON格式。 JSON文件实际存储时一个JSON对象或者一个JSON数组。...pandas导入JSON数据 用Pandas模块read_json方法导入JSON数据,其中参数为JSON文件 pandas导入txt文件 当需要导入存在于txt文件数据时,可以使用pandas...在该例中,首先通过pandasread_csv方法导入sales.csv文件前10行数据,然后使用pandasto_csv方法将导入数据输出为sales_new.csv文件。...2.2 xlsx格式数据输出 【例】对于上一小节中问题,销售文件格式为sales.xlsx文件,这种情况下该如何处理?...指缺失数据表示方式。 columes:序列,可选参数,要编辑列。 header:布尔型或字符串列表,默认值为True。如果给定字符串列表,则表示它是列名称别名。

    15410

    如何使用Python构建价格追踪器进行价格追踪

    本文将向大家介绍如何用Python采集器建立一个可立即实现电商价格跟踪可扩展价格追踪器。价格追踪器是什么?价格追踪器是一个定期在电商网站上抓取产品价格并提取价格变动程序。...●Pandas:用于过滤产品数据和读写CSV文件。此外,您也可以创建一个虚拟环境让整个过程更加有序。...安装完成后,创建一个新Python文件并导入以下代码:import smtplibimport pandas as pdimport requests from bs4 import BeautifulSoup...读取产品 URL 列表 存储和管理产品URL最简单办法就是将它们保存在CSV或JSON文件中。这次使用是CSV,便于我们通过文本编辑器或电子表格应用程序进行更新。...如果价格追踪器发现产品价格降至低于alert_price字段值,它将触发一个电子邮件提醒。?CSV中产品URL样本可以使用Pandas读取CSV文件并转换为字典对象。

    6.1K40

    实战案例!Python批量识别银行卡号码并且写入Excel,小白也可以轻松使用~

    今天我们就来学习一下,如何用1行代码,自动识别银行卡信息并且自动生成Excel文件 第一步:识别一张银行卡 识别银行卡代码最简单,只需要1行腾讯云AI第三方库potencent代码,如下所示。...支持对复印件、翻拍件、边框遮挡银行卡进行告警,可应用于各种银行卡信息有效性校验场景,金融行业身份认证、第三方支付绑卡等场景。...Excel文件,可以直接使用之前推荐过30讲 Python + Excel自动化办公,传送门:点我直达 代码如下。...import os from os.path import join import pandas as pd # home_path = "你存放大量银行卡图片位置" home_path = r"C.../银行卡信息(程序员晚枫).xlsx") 运行后结果如下,会在同级目录下,生成一个Excel文件 第三步:优化思路 以上代码还可以进一步优化,例如: 路径处理改为Path方法,适配更多平台 变量名称更简洁

    92820

    Python 办公自动化,全网最全干货来了!

    02 六主题,专治复制粘贴 全书共17章,分为6个部分,分别是基础篇、文件篇、Excel篇、Word篇、PPT篇、PDF篇。...文件篇包括第3~4 章 详细讲解如何用Python实现文件操作自动化。从什么是计算机文件,以及如何用Python读写文件,到引入 os 模块。...第 9 章介绍如何结合 pandas 库实现更强大数据分析能力,首先介绍pandas 库中常用运算,然后讲解如何排序、求和以及求最值,最后介绍如何拆分工作表和制作数据透视表。...第15 章介绍如何用 Python 读取 PPT 中文字、图片和图表,以及将 PPT 转换为 Word、Excel 或者保存到本地文件夹。...02 咖推荐,精彩书评 工欲善其事,必先利其器。一些办公场景如果有Python 加持,很多事情就会变得简单起来。

    1.4K30

    【银行卡识别】Python批量识别银行卡号码并且写入Excel,小白也可以轻松使用~

    今天我们就来学习一下,如何用1行代码,自动识别银行卡信息并且自动生成Excel文件~图片第一步:识别一张银行卡识别银行卡代码最简单,只需要1行腾讯云AI第三方库potencent代码,如下所示。...支持对复印件、翻拍件、边框遮挡银行卡进行告警,可应用于各种银行卡信息有效性校验场景,金融行业身份认证、第三方支付绑卡等场景。...以上代码中,关于potencent-config.toml配置方法,可以参考昨天视频讲解第二步:写入Excel想把上面这个代码用来识别大量银行卡信息,并且将识别后返回数据,全部写入Excel文件...import osfrom os.path import joinimport pandas as pd# home_path = "你存放大量银行卡图片位置"home_path = r"C:\Users.../银行卡信息(程序员晚枫).xlsx")运行后结果如下,会在同级目录下,生成一个Excel文件图片第三步:优化思路以上代码还可以进一步优化,例如:路径处理改为Path方法,适配更多平台变量名称更简洁

    1.8K00

    三行代码产出完美数据分析报告!

    可以帮助我们节省大量时间,对于刚刚学习数据分析小伙伴可以带来非常帮助。 本篇文章我们介绍目前最流行AutoEDA工具包。...其中: pandas_profilingdf.profile_report()扩展了pandas DataFrame以方便进行快速数据分析。...分位数统计,最小值、Q1、中位数、Q3、最大值、范围、四分位距 描述性统计数据,均值、众数、标准差、总和、中值绝对偏差、变异系数、峰态、偏度 出现最多值 直方图 高度相关变量、Spearman、...、高密度可视化文件,只需两行代码即可开启探索性数据分析并输出一个完全独立 HTML 应用程序。...给出任何输入文件(CSV、txt或json),AutoViz都可以对其进行可视化。AutoViz结果会以非常多图片都形式存在文件夹下方。

    87530

    何用 Pandas 存取和交换数据?

    CSV/TSV 我们来看最常见两种格式,分别是: csv :逗号分隔数据文本文件; tsv :制表符分隔数据文本文件; 先尝试把 Pandas 数据框导出为 csv 文件。...将生成 csv 文件拖入文本编辑器内,效果如下: ? 你可以清楚地看到,逗号分割了表头和数据。 有意思是,因为第一句评论里包含了换行符,所以就真的记录到两行上面。而文本两端,有引号包裹。...df.to_csv('data.tsv', index=None, sep='\t') 生成文件名为 data.tsv 。我们还是在编辑器里面打开它看看。 ?...如果不包裹,读取时候可就要出问题了。程序就会傻乎乎地把 “第八季” 当成标记,扔掉后面的内容了。 你看现在编辑着色,实际上已经错误判断分列了。 ? 我们试着用 Pandas 把它读取回来。...我们在做数据分析时候,难免会调用 Pandas 以外软件包,继续分析我们用 Pandas 预处理后文件。 这个时候,就要看对方支持文件格式有哪些了。

    1.9K20

    Jupytext就是你需要

    其中比较重要是版本控制,Jupyter Notebook 采用JSON 结构,可读性比较差。而版本控制能让我们发觉潜在优秀代码,我们可以关注代码变化而挖掘到底哪些是重要。...在上面的视频中,项目作者展示了如何快速使用 Jupytext,我们可以使用最喜欢纯文本编辑器或 IDE 来编辑 Jupyter Notebook。...更有意思是,如果我们需要使用 IDE 重构代码或其它操作,那么可以直接在 PyCharm 中编辑并保存 Python 文件。...你可以在自己喜欢编辑器中边界文本表示。编辑完成后,在 Jupyter 中刷新 notebook 即可:输入单元加载自文本文件,输出单元重新加载自.ipynb 文件。...程序员如何用Python了解女朋友情绪变化? 嫌pandas慢又不想改代码怎么办?来试试Modin 数据分析这碗饭,该怎么吃?

    1.6K40
    领券